Understanding Crossville’s Unique Roofing Challenges
Humid Subtropical Climate Pressure
Crossville’s weather pattern is distinguished by warm summers, cool winters, and significant humidity year-round. This moisture can infiltrate microscopic fissures in shingles, underlayment, and flashing, expanding and contracting as temperatures fluctuate. The repeated freeze-thaw cycles in winter specifically accelerate granular loss on asphalt shingles and can corrode fasteners on metal roofs. HEP’s inspection teams measure moisture retention in decking and insulation, then suggest targeted interventions to mitigate vapor intrusion before rot, mildew, or black mold gains a foothold.
Seasonal Storm Patterns and Wind Loads
Spring thunderstorms and fall wind events place sudden, high stress on roof assemblies. Gusts funnel through the Cumberland Plateau, occasionally exceeding recommended design loads for many residential structures. HEP inspectors check uplift resistance along eaves and ridges while examining hip and valley connections for wind-induced separation. By mapping these high-risk zones, HEP helps homeowners reinforce vulnerable areas before the next storm front arrives, rather than after costly water intrusion occurs.

Structural Integrity Evaluation
Roof framing must bear live loads such as snow and maintenance traffic, in addition to dead loads intrinsic to the roofing materials. HEP inspects rafters, trusses, and sheathing for sagging, deflection, or insect damage. Engineers cross-reference findings with building plans to verify that load paths remain uncompromised.
Attic and Ventilation Review
Balanced airflow in the attic is fundamental to thermal efficiency. Insufficient ventilation causes heat buildup in summer and condensation in winter—each accelerating roof material degradation. HEP evaluates:
- Intake and exhaust vent ratios
- Baffle installation and condition
- Insulation depth and moisture content
Moisture and Leak Detection
Using infrared thermography and non-invasive moisture meters, inspectors locate active leaks and latent damp areas invisible to the naked eye. These tools highlight temperature differentials that signal water saturation beneath the roof covering or in wall cavities.

Typical Roofing Materials in Crossville and How HEP Approaches Each
Asphalt Shingles
The popularity of asphalt shingles stems from cost-effectiveness and relative ease of installation. HEP inspects:
- Adhesive strip activation and bonding strength
- Granule coverage uniformity
- Nail penetration depth and spacing
- Vent pipe gasket elasticity
Metal Roofing
Standing seam and exposed-fastener panels demand specialized assessment. Expansion and contraction, if unmanaged, can loosen screws and stress panel seams. HEP measures:
- Panel clip movement allowance
- Sealant bead condition along seams
- Galvanic corrosion at mixed-metal contact points
Tile and Slate Systems
Though less common, tile and slate roofs add longevity and curb appeal. Their weight, however, necessitates rigorous sub-structure evaluation. During inspections, HEP scrutinizes:
- Mortar bedding stability
- Crack propagation in tiles
- Underlayment thickness and overlap compliance
Early Warning Signs HEP Looks For During a Roof Inspection
Visible Surface Deterioration
- Curling or cupping shingles
- Popped nails or screw heads
- Bleached or streaked panels signaling UV degradation
Flashing Failures
- Deteriorated step flashing along sidewalls
- Loose counter-flashing at chimneys
- Sealant gaps around skylight perimeters
Gutter and Downspout Concerns
- Bent or clogged gutter sections that impede drainage
- Separated downspout seams causing fascia rot
- Improper gutter slope resulting in standing water
Interior Manifestations of Roof Trouble
- Water stains on ceilings or upper-story walls
- Peeling or bubbling paint near roof intersections
- Musty odors in attic spaces indicating trapped moisture

Preventive Maintenance Recommendations Tailored to Crossville Homes
Gutter Maintenance Schedule
Regular clearing of gutters reduces hydrostatic pressure along the eaves. HEP recommends biannual cleanings—after leaf fall and following spring pollen shedding—to preserve fascia boards and shingle edges.
Tree Limb Management
Heavy branches can scrape roofing surfaces during high winds or deposit organic debris that traps moisture. HEP advises maintaining a clearance radius of at least 6–8 feet between foliage and roof planes.
Attic Insulation Adjustments
Inadequate insulation permits heat transfer that leads to snow melt and refreeze at eaves, forming ice dams. By inspecting R-value performance, HEP helps homeowners upgrade insulation with moisture-resistant materials suited to Crossville’s humidity levels.
Common Roofing Issues Found in Older Crossville Neighborhoods
Many residential districts constructed during the mid-20th century exhibit architectural styles that, while charming, sometimes pose modern roofing challenges. HEP frequently identifies:
- Decking composed of thinner planks unable to support heavier contemporary roofing materials
- Dated metal plumbing vents with brittle lead boots
- Dormer valleys lacking modern ice and water shield membranes
- Layered roofing systems where new shingles were applied over existing ones, concealing rot beneath
Careful inspection and tailored remediation strategies allow these classic homes to retain aesthetic authenticity while achieving present-day performance standards.

Myths About Roof Inspections Dispelled
Myth 1: “A new roof doesn’t need inspection for at least five years.”
Even freshly installed roofs can suffer from incorrect flashing, under-driven nails, or manufacturer defects. HEP’s first-year inspection checks that installation occurred as specified and that warranties remain intact.
Myth 2: “If there are no leaks inside, the roof is fine.”
Water can migrate along rafters, manifesting in areas far from its point of entry. HEP’s moisture detection equipment locates hidden infiltration before it shows up on interior finishes.
Myth 3: “Roof inspections are unnecessary until resale.”
Deferred maintenance often results in higher remediation costs that erode resale profits. Annual inspections spread minor repair expenses across manageable intervals and help preserve property value.

Emerging Roofing Technologies Evaluated During Inspections
Integrated Solar Roofing
Building-integrated photovoltaics blend solar modules directly into roofing materials, offering clean energy without bulky panels. When HEP inspects a roof fitted with this technology, technicians verify:
- Proper flashing around electrical conduits
- Module alignment to prevent water intrusion
- Heat dissipation gaps that protect shingles from thermal stress
Synthetic Underlayment Advances
Modern synthetic underlayments resist UV radiation, offer higher tear strength, and boast improved breathability over traditional felt. HEP inspectors confirm:
- Correct overlap patterns and fastening schedules
- Compatibility with selected roof coverings
- Adequate venting to allow trapped moisture to escape
Self-Healing Membranes
Elastomeric membranes infused with microencapsulated polymers can seal minor punctures autonomously. During inspections, HEP evaluates:
- Membrane elasticity retention under Crossville’s temperature swings
- Evidence of activated self-healing along hail impact zones
- Seam integrity where membranes intersect with flashing elements
Smart Sensor Integration
Wireless moisture sensors embedded beneath the roof deck transmit real-time humidity levels to homeowners’ devices. HEP’s team ensures:
- Sensor calibration accuracy
- Battery longevity or photovoltaic charging function
- Seamless data communication without interference from attic insulation
